I purchased this for my 3-year old daughter who's really into Spiderman right now. When it arrived, I was thoroughly surprised with regard to how many joints are movable on this action figure. You can pose Spidey in just about any position imaginable. Head, shoulders, elbows, wrists, hips, knees, legs, fingers, feet, ankles...all movable. Each individual finger (except the thumbs) and the toes (as a single unit) are even movable. I often find Spidey laying around the house in undignified poses, looking more like the star of a Broadway musical rather than a crime fighting action hero, so I take the time to reposition him and man him up a little.
